Output 31cdeb23f82f370e10a2117e182e011edf44be55e3bb4e9fbc771775c2bf0e0b:41

value
9702428
script pubkey
OP_0 OP_PUSHBYTES_20 6b675754b0355cd856d63a7e953307c50647fa24
address
bc1qddn4w49sx4wds4kk8flf2vc8c5ry073ydj3a28
transaction
31cdeb23f82f370e10a2117e182e011edf44be55e3bb4e9fbc771775c2bf0e0b
spent
true